摘要

Abstract

Based on comparison of the two categories of foraminifera fauna living on the modern open muddy tidal flats in the west coast of Bohai Bay, with or without chenier ridge, the authors thoroughly studied the variability indicating sea level elevations by dif⁃ferent foram assemblages in these two kinds of environment. Each category of forams, consisting of five assemblages and correspond⁃ing to five subzones, i.e., high salt marsh, low salt marsh, upper intertidal, upper-middle intertidal and middle-lower intertidal suben⁃vironments, was separated successively by MHWST, MHW, MHWNT and MSL, and investigated in detail. As a result, the specific forams-attached sediment from each subzone on tidal surface can be recognized as a high-accuracy sea level indicator, of which the reconstructed elevation point lies in the middle of the subzone with an error of half of the vertical range. It is evident that the exis⁃tence of the local chenier body can exert an influence on the composition of foram assemblages, and such an influence tends to de⁃cline gradually from high to low water, and finally fades out seaward beneath the MHWNT.
